Essential Duties:
Supports the mission of Astera Health through personal conduct and behaviors that contribute ideas and suggestions, is helpful and friendly, demonstrates regular attendance and punctuality, and adheres to organizational policies and rules.Be a role model of Astera Health culture and core values.Prepares the operating room with the appropriate supplies and equipment for the procedure to be performed. Cleans and restocks the OR upon the completion of a procedure.Anticipates and obtains necessary supplies to fulfill needs of the surgeon during a procedure. Assures aseptic technique throughout a procedure.Monitors and evaluates the instruments and supplies during a procedure to ensure the safety of the surgical patient.Transports patients in surgical area to prepare for surgery.Assists surgeon and surgical assistant during surgical procedures. Acts as surgeon's assistant if needed.Assists with preparation of any culture or tissue for specimen collection.Prepares and sterilizes instruments in CSR. Orders supplies for OR, CSR and PAR. Routinely does outdates as scheduled, cleans and restocks to assist with sterile and efficient maintenance of supplies and instruments.Assists surgeon in the Endoscopy room. Processes endoscopes according to standards.Complies with established policies and procedures for safety and infection control to ensure the well-being of patient and staff, i.e., body substance isolation, fire, disaster.Maintains knowledge base on available resources and adheres to policies and procedures.Initiates and/or assists with Basic Cardiac Life Support in cardiopulmonary arrests and maintains annual CPR training.Qualifications Licenses & Certifications
